Devam etmeden \u00f6nce hasarl\u0131 par\u00e7alar\u0131 de\u011fi\u015ftirin.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\"><strong>\u00d6nerilen G\u00fcvenlik Kontrol Listesi:<\/strong><\/p>\n\n\n\n<ol class=\"wp-block-list\" >\n\n<li>Sigortadaki g\u00fcc\u00fc kesin ve kilitleyin.<\/li>\n<li><a href=\"https:\/\/yoderelectric.com\/the-complete-guide-to-hot-tub-and-spa-wiring-safety\/\" rel=\"nofollow noopener\" target=\"_blank\">GFCI'nin d\u00fczg\u00fcn \u00e7al\u0131\u015ft\u0131\u011f\u0131n\u0131 test edin.<\/a>.<\/li>\n<li>Uzatma kablolar\u0131ndan ka\u00e7\u0131n\u0131n; \u00f6zel bir devre kullan\u0131n.<\/li>\n<li>Kablolama ve konnekt\u00f6rleri korozyon veya a\u015f\u0131nma a\u00e7\u0131s\u0131ndan inceleyin.<\/li>\n<li>T\u00fcm elektrik alanlar\u0131n\u0131 kuru ve temiz tutun.<\/li>\n<li>S\u0131k sigorta atmas\u0131 gibi elektrik sorunlar\u0131n\u0131n belirtilerini izleyin.<\/li>\n\n<\/ol>\n\n\n\n<h3 class=\"wp-block-heading\" >Diren\u00e7 Testi Yapma<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>Multimetre Kullanma<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Diren\u00e7 testi, \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131z\u0131n do\u011fru \u00e7al\u0131\u015f\u0131p \u00e7al\u0131\u015fmad\u0131\u011f\u0131n\u0131 belirlemenize yard\u0131mc\u0131 olur. Multimetrenizi ohm (\u03a9) ayar\u0131na getirin. Bir probu \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131n her bir terminaline dokundurun. Bu test s\u0131ras\u0131nda g\u00fcc\u00fcn kapal\u0131 kald\u0131\u011f\u0131ndan emin olun. Ekranda sabit bir okuma g\u00f6rmelisiniz.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" >Test Sonu\u00e7lar\u0131n\u0131 Anlama<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">\u00c7o\u011fu i\u015flevsel s\u0131cak k\u00fcvet \u0131s\u0131t\u0131c\u0131 eleman\u0131 <a href=\"https:\/\/lesliespool.com\/blog\/spa-electrical-component-testing-ohms.html\" rel=\"nofollow noopener\" target=\"_blank\">10 ila 14 ohm<\/a>. aras\u0131nda diren\u00e7 g\u00f6sterir. 4.0 ila 5.5 kW aras\u0131 derecelendirilmi\u015f elemanlar i\u00e7in, <a href=\"https:\/\/lesliespool.com\/blog\/testing-elements.html\" rel=\"nofollow noopener\" target=\"_blank\">9 ila 12 ohm<\/a>. aras\u0131nda okumalar bekleyin. 240 voltta 5.5 kW'l\u0131k bir \u0131s\u0131t\u0131c\u0131 tipik olarak yakla\u015f\u0131k <a href=\"https:\/\/www.justanswer.com\/appliance\/2idme-check-hot-tub-heater-failed-resistance.html\" rel=\"nofollow noopener\" target=\"_blank\">10.5 ohm<\/a>. \u00f6l\u00e7er. Multimetreniz s\u0131f\u0131r (k\u0131sa devre) veya sonsuz diren\u00e7 (a\u00e7\u0131k devre) g\u00f6steriyorsa, eleman ar\u0131zalanm\u0131\u015ft\u0131r ve de\u011fi\u015ftirilmesi gerekir.<\/p>\n\n\n\n<figure class=\"wp-block-table\">\n<table class=\"has-fixed-layout\">\n\n<thead>\n<tr><th>Diren\u00e7 Okumas\u0131<\/th><th>Ne Anlama Gelir<\/th><th>Gerekli \u0130\u015flem<\/th><\/tr>\n<\/thead>\n<tbody>\n<tr><td>9\u201314 ohm<\/td><td>Eleman i\u015flevseldir<\/td><td>\u0130\u015flem gerekmez<\/td><\/tr>\n<tr><td>0 ohm<\/td><td>K\u0131sa devre<\/td><td>Eleman\u0131 de\u011fi\u015ftirin<\/td><\/tr>\n<tr><td>Sonsuz\/Y\u00fcksek<\/td><td>A\u00e7\u0131k devre veya ar\u0131zal\u0131<\/td><td>Eleman\u0131 de\u011fi\u015ftirin<\/td><\/tr>\n<\/tbody>\n\n<\/table>\n<\/figure>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p>1000 ohm'un \u00fczerinde diren\u00e7 veya normal aral\u0131\u011f\u0131n d\u0131\u015f\u0131nda herhangi bir okuma g\u00f6r\u00fcrseniz, \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 de\u011fi\u015ftirin.<\/p>\n<\/blockquote>\n\n\n\n<h3 class=\"wp-block-heading\" >K\u0131sa Devre ve Toprak Ka\u00e7a\u011f\u0131 Testi<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>Topra\u011fa K\u0131sa Devre Kontrol\u00fc<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Ayr\u0131ca \u0131s\u0131t\u0131c\u0131 terminalleri ile toprak aras\u0131nda k\u0131sa devre olup olmad\u0131\u011f\u0131n\u0131 da kontrol etmelisiniz. Bir probu bir terminale, di\u011ferini \u0131s\u0131t\u0131c\u0131n\u0131n metal bir par\u00e7as\u0131na veya toprak kablosuna yerle\u015ftirin. Her iki terminal i\u00e7in de tekrarlay\u0131n. Burada \u00f6l\u00e7\u00fclebilir herhangi bir diren\u00e7, eleman\u0131n toprak ka\u00e7a\u011f\u0131 oldu\u011fu anlam\u0131na gelir.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" >Ar\u0131zal\u0131 Okumalar\u0131n Anlam\u0131<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">K\u0131sa devreler ve toprak ka\u00e7aklar\u0131 genellikle <a href=\"https:\/\/lesliespool.com\/blog\/top-5-hot-tub-heater-problems.html\" rel=\"nofollow noopener\" target=\"_blank\">Kuru ate\u015fleme<\/a>, kire\u00e7lenme veya korozyondan kaynaklan\u0131r. Is\u0131t\u0131c\u0131y\u0131 susuz \u00e7al\u0131\u015ft\u0131rmak bobini ve k\u0131l\u0131f\u0131 eritebilir ve k\u0131sa devrelere neden olabilir. Sert su veya uygun olmayan su kimyas\u0131, elemana zarar veren kire\u00e7lenme veya korozyona yol a\u00e7ar. Gev\u015fek veya hasarl\u0131 kablolama da elektrik ar\u0131zas\u0131 riskini art\u0131r\u0131r.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n\n<li>K\u0131sa devrelerin yayg\u0131n nedenleri \u015funlard\u0131r:\n<ul>\n<li>Is\u0131t\u0131c\u0131 eleman\u0131n\u0131n susuz \u00e7al\u0131\u015ft\u0131r\u0131lmas\u0131<\/li>\n<li>Sert veya y\u00fcksek kalsiyumlu sudan kaynaklanan kire\u00e7 birikimi<\/li>\n<li><a href=\"https:\/\/spacare.com\/top5failuresofspaandhottubheatersheatingelements\" rel=\"nofollow noopener\" target=\"_blank\">D\u00fc\u015f\u00fck pH veya alkalinite nedeniyle korozyon<\/a><\/li>\n<li>Eleman g\u00f6vdesinde \u00e7atlaklar veya delikler<\/li>\n<li>Hasarl\u0131 veya gev\u015fek kablolama<\/li>\n<\/ul>\n<\/li>\n\n<\/ul>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p>Topra\u011fa k\u0131sa devre veya anormal diren\u00e7 tespit ederseniz, g\u00fcvenli \u00e7al\u0131\u015fmay\u0131 sa\u011flamak i\u00e7in \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 derhal de\u011fi\u015ftirin. Bu par\u00e7alar\u0131n haz\u0131r olmas\u0131 gecikmeleri \u00f6nler ve yeni spa \u0131s\u0131t\u0131c\u0131n\u0131z i\u00e7in do\u011fru s\u0131zd\u0131rmazl\u0131k ve elektrik ba\u011flant\u0131s\u0131 sa\u011flar.<\/p>\n\n\n\n<figure class=\"wp-block-table\">\n<table class=\"has-fixed-layout\">\n\n<thead>\n<tr><th>Yedek Par\u00e7a<\/th><th>A\u00e7\u0131klama\/Kullan\u0131m<\/th><\/tr>\n<\/thead>\n<tbody>\n<tr><td>Is\u0131t\u0131c\u0131 Rezistans<\/td><td>S\u0131cak k\u00fcvet modeliniz ve watt gereksinimlerinizle e\u015fle\u015fmelidir<\/td><\/tr>\n<tr><td>Is\u0131t\u0131c\u0131 Contas\u0131<\/td><td>Is\u0131t\u0131c\u0131 eleman\u0131n\u0131 s\u0131zd\u0131rmaz hale getirir; en iyi sonu\u00e7 i\u00e7in de\u011fi\u015ftirin<\/td><\/tr>\n<tr><td>K\u00f6pr\u00fc Bant\u0131<\/td><td>Is\u0131t\u0131c\u0131y\u0131 kontrol panosuna ba\u011flar; korozyona u\u011fram\u0131\u015f veya hasar g\u00f6rm\u00fc\u015fse de\u011fi\u015ftirin<\/td><\/tr>\n<tr><td>Elektrik Konnekt\u00f6rleri<\/td><td>Kablolar ve terminaller; a\u015f\u0131nm\u0131\u015f veya korozyona u\u011fram\u0131\u015fsa inceleyin ve de\u011fi\u015ftirin<\/td><\/tr>\n<\/tbody>\n\n<\/table>\n<\/figure>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p>\u0130pucu: S\u0131z\u0131nt\u0131lar\u0131 \u00f6nlemek ve sistem b\u00fct\u00fcnl\u00fc\u011f\u00fcn\u00fc korumak i\u00e7in \u0131s\u0131t\u0131c\u0131 eleman\u0131 de\u011fi\u015fimi s\u0131ras\u0131nda O-ringleri ve contalar\u0131 her zaman de\u011fi\u015ftirin.<\/p>\n<\/blockquote>\n\n\n\n<h3 class=\"wp-block-heading\" >Eski Is\u0131t\u0131c\u0131 Eleman\u0131n\u0131n \u00c7\u0131kar\u0131lmas\u0131<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>G\u00fc\u00e7 ve Kablolar\u0131n Ba\u011flant\u0131s\u0131n\u0131 Kesme<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Devre kesiciden g\u00fcc\u00fc kapatarak ba\u015flay\u0131n. Multimetrenizi kullanarak s\u0131cak k\u00fcvetin tamamen enerjisiz oldu\u011funu do\u011frulay\u0131n. Is\u0131t\u0131c\u0131 d\u00fczene\u011fine ula\u015fmak i\u00e7in eri\u015fim panelini \u00e7\u0131kar\u0131n. T\u00fcm elektrik kablolar\u0131n\u0131 \u0131s\u0131t\u0131c\u0131 eleman\u0131ndan dikkatlice ay\u0131r\u0131n. Do\u011fru yeniden montaj i\u00e7in her kablonun konumunu ve rengini not edin. <a href=\"https:\/\/spadepot.com\/pages\/spa-heater-element\" rel=\"nofollow noopener\" target=\"_blank\">Elektrik terminallerini gev\u015fetirken iki anahtar kullan\u0131n<\/a> \u2013 su giri\u015fine izin verebilecek epoksi contan\u0131n hasar g\u00f6rmesini \u00f6nlemek i\u00e7in.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" >Vanalar\u0131 Kapatma ve Su D\u00f6k\u00fclmesini Y\u00f6netme<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\"><a href=\"https:\/\/parts4tubs.com\/hot-tub-heater-element-replacement\/\" rel=\"nofollow noopener\" target=\"_blank\">S\u0131cak k\u00fcvet suyunu \u0131s\u0131t\u0131c\u0131 eleman\u0131 seviyesinin alt\u0131na bo\u015falt\u0131n<\/a>. Bu ad\u0131m suyun ekipman b\u00f6lmesine d\u00f6k\u00fclmesini ve hasara yol a\u00e7mas\u0131n\u0131 \u00f6nler. S\u0131cak k\u00fcvetinizde kapatma vanalar\u0131 varsa, \u0131s\u0131t\u0131c\u0131 d\u00fczene\u011fini izole etmek i\u00e7in bunlar\u0131 kapat\u0131n. Art\u0131k suyu toplamak i\u00e7in \u0131s\u0131t\u0131c\u0131n\u0131n alt\u0131na havlu veya s\u0131\u011f bir tepsi yerle\u015ftirin. Elektrik bile\u015fenlerini korumak i\u00e7in \u00e7al\u0131\u015fma alan\u0131n\u0131 her zaman kuru tutun.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n\n<li>\u0130nceleme veya onar\u0131m \u00f6ncesinde t\u00fcm elektrik g\u00fcc\u00fcn\u00fc her zaman kesin.<\/li>\n<li>Kuru yanma hasar\u0131n\u0131 \u00f6nlemek i\u00e7in servis sonras\u0131nda tesisattaki havay\u0131 bo\u015falt\u0131n.<\/li>\n<li>G\u00fcc\u00fc geri a\u00e7madan \u00f6nce tesisat sisteminin s\u0131z\u0131nt\u0131s\u0131z oldu\u011fundan emin olun.<\/li>\n\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\" >O-Ringlerin ve Contalar\u0131n \u00c7\u0131kar\u0131lmas\u0131<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Kablolar\u0131 ay\u0131rd\u0131ktan ve suyu bo\u015faltt\u0131ktan sonra, \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 sabitleyen montaj donan\u0131mlar\u0131n\u0131 \u00e7\u0131kar\u0131n. Eski \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 yuvas\u0131ndan nazik\u00e7e \u00e7\u0131kar\u0131n. Eski O-ringleri veya contalar\u0131 \u00e7\u0131kar\u0131n. S\u0131zd\u0131rmazl\u0131k y\u00fczeylerinde kal\u0131nt\u0131 veya korozyon olup olmad\u0131\u011f\u0131n\u0131 inceleyin ve bunlar\u0131 iyice temizleyin. \u00c7\u0131karma s\u0131ras\u0131nda \u0131s\u0131t\u0131c\u0131 g\u00f6vdesine veya \u00e7evresindeki tesisata zarar vermemeye dikkat edin.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" >Yeni Is\u0131t\u0131c\u0131 Eleman\u0131n\u0131n Tak\u0131lmas\u0131<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>Eleman\u0131n Konumland\u0131r\u0131lmas\u0131 ve Sabitlenmesi<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Yeni spa \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 haz\u0131rlay\u0131n: <a href=\"https:\/\/parts4tubs.com\/hot-tub-heater-element-replacement\/\" rel=\"nofollow noopener\" target=\"_blank\">\u00fcreticiniz \u00f6neriyorsa di\u015fli k\u0131sm\u0131 Teflon bantla<\/a> sar\u0131n. Yeni spa \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 yuvas\u0131na yerle\u015ftirin ve do\u011fru hizaland\u0131\u011f\u0131ndan emin olun. Montaj donan\u0131m\u0131yla sabitleyin ve su ge\u00e7irmez bir s\u0131zd\u0131rmazl\u0131k olu\u015fturmak i\u00e7in e\u015fit \u015fekilde s\u0131k\u0131n. Di\u015flere veya \u0131s\u0131t\u0131c\u0131 g\u00f6vdesine zarar verebilece\u011finden a\u015f\u0131r\u0131 s\u0131kmay\u0131n.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" >Kablolar\u0131n ve Sens\u00f6rlerin Yeniden Ba\u011flanmas\u0131<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Elektrik kablolar\u0131n\u0131 yeni spa \u0131s\u0131t\u0131c\u0131 eleman\u0131na yeniden ba\u011flay\u0131n ve her kabloyu orijinal terminaliyle e\u015fle\u015ftirin. Ark olu\u015fumunu veya a\u015f\u0131r\u0131 \u0131s\u0131nmay\u0131 \u00f6nlemek i\u00e7in t\u00fcm ba\u011flant\u0131lar\u0131 g\u00fcvenli \u015fekilde s\u0131k\u0131n. S\u0131cak k\u00fcvetiniz sens\u00f6rler veya k\u00f6pr\u00fc \u015feritleri kullan\u0131yorsa, bunlar\u0131 \u00fcreticinin talimatlar\u0131na g\u00f6re yeniden ba\u011flay\u0131n. Her ba\u011flant\u0131y\u0131 do\u011fru yerle\u015fim ve s\u0131kl\u0131k a\u00e7\u0131s\u0131ndan iki kez kontrol edin.<\/p>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p>S\u0131cak k\u00fcvet modelinize \u00f6zel kablo \u015femas\u0131n\u0131 her zaman izleyin. Yanl\u0131\u015f kablolama \u0131s\u0131t\u0131c\u0131 ar\u0131zas\u0131na veya g\u00fcvenlik tehlikelerine neden olabilir.<\/p>\n<\/blockquote>\n\n\n\n<h4 class=\"wp-block-heading\" >O-Ringlerin ve Contalar\u0131n De\u011fi\u015ftirilmesi<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Do\u011fru s\u0131zd\u0131rmazl\u0131k sa\u011flamak i\u00e7in yeni O-ringler veya contalar tak\u0131n. \u00d6neriliyorsa O-ringleri az miktarda silikon gresiyle ya\u011flay\u0131n. S\u0131k\u0131\u015fmay\u0131 veya hizas\u0131z yerle\u015fimi \u00f6nlemek i\u00e7in contalar\u0131 dikkatli konumland\u0131r\u0131n. Bu a\u015famada a\u015f\u0131nm\u0131\u015f veya hasarl\u0131 elektrik konnekt\u00f6rlerini de\u011fi\u015ftirin. \u0130\u015finizi bitirdi\u011finizde eri\u015fim panelini kapat\u0131n ve sabitleyin.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Is\u0131t\u0131c\u0131 eleman\u0131 de\u011fi\u015fiminin temel ad\u0131mlar\u0131n\u0131 art\u0131k tamamlad\u0131n\u0131z. Dikkatli testler yat\u0131r\u0131m\u0131n\u0131z\u0131 korur ve k\u00fcvetinizin keyfini her \u00e7\u0131kard\u0131\u011f\u0131n\u0131zda size g\u00f6n\u00fcl rahatl\u0131\u011f\u0131 verir.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" >Is\u0131t\u0131c\u0131 Eleman De\u011fi\u015fimi Sonras\u0131 G\u00fcvenlik \u0130pu\u00e7lar\u0131 ve Sorun Giderme<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" >Ka\u00e7\u0131n\u0131lmas\u0131 Gereken Yayg\u0131n Hatalar<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>A\u015f\u0131r\u0131 S\u0131kma veya Ba\u011flant\u0131lara Zarar Verme<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Her ba\u011flant\u0131y\u0131 m\u00fcmk\u00fcn oldu\u011funca s\u0131kma iste\u011fi duyabilirsiniz. Ancak, \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131 veya elektrik terminallerini a\u015f\u0131r\u0131 s\u0131kmak di\u015fleri \u00e7atlatabilir, O-ringleri ezebilir veya epoksi contaya zarar verebilir. Bu hata genellikle s\u0131z\u0131nt\u0131lara yol a\u00e7ar veya suyun elektrik kontaklar\u0131na ula\u015fmas\u0131na izin vererek g\u00fcvenlik tehlikesi olu\u015fturur. Her zaman sabit bir el kullan\u0131n ve diren\u00e7 hissetti\u011finizde s\u0131kmay\u0131 b\u0131rak\u0131n. Kurulum s\u0131ras\u0131nda terminalleri b\u00fckmekten veya b\u00fckerek zorlamaktan ka\u00e7\u0131n\u0131n. Bu uygulama su giri\u015fini \u00f6nler ve \u0131s\u0131t\u0131c\u0131 eleman\u0131n\u0131z\u0131n \u00f6mr\u00fcn\u00fc uzat\u0131r.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" >S\u0131z\u0131nt\u0131 veya Elektrik Kontrollerini Atlama<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Is\u0131t\u0131c\u0131 eleman de\u011fi\u015fimini tamamlad\u0131ktan sonra, s\u0131z\u0131nt\u0131lar\u0131 kontrol etmeli ve t\u00fcm elektrik ba\u011flant\u0131lar\u0131n\u0131 do\u011frulamal\u0131s\u0131n\u0131z. Bu ad\u0131mlar\u0131 atlamak su hasar\u0131na, elektrik k\u0131sa devrelerine veya hatta ba\u015far\u0131s\u0131z bir onar\u0131ma yol a\u00e7abilir. K\u00fcveti yeniden doldurduktan sonra \u0131s\u0131t\u0131c\u0131 alan\u0131n\u0131 nem a\u00e7\u0131s\u0131ndan her zaman inceleyin. Is\u0131t\u0131c\u0131 terminallerinde do\u011fru gerilim ve direnci do\u011frulamak i\u00e7in bir multimetre kullan\u0131n. Bu kontroller sorunlar\u0131 erken yakalaman\u0131za ve daha ciddi k\u00fcvet \u0131s\u0131t\u0131c\u0131 sorunlar\u0131n\u0131 \u00f6nlemenize yard\u0131mc\u0131 olur.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" >Kal\u0131c\u0131 Sorunlar\u0131n Giderilmesi<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\" >Is\u0131t\u0131c\u0131 G\u00fc\u00e7 Alm\u0131yor<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">De\u011fi\u015fim sonras\u0131 s\u0131cak k\u00fcvet \u0131s\u0131t\u0131c\u0131n\u0131z g\u00fc\u00e7 alm\u0131yorsa, \u015fu ad\u0131m ad\u0131m yakla\u015f\u0131m\u0131 izleyin:<\/p>\n\n\n\n<ol class=\"wp-block-list\" >\n\n<li><a href=\"https:\/\/www.justanswer.com\/pool-and-spa\/rk4t2-replaced-heat-element-741-not-heating-control.html\" rel=\"nofollow noopener\" target=\"_blank\">G\u00fc\u00e7 kayna\u011f\u0131n\u0131 do\u011frulay\u0131n ve \u0131s\u0131t\u0131c\u0131 terminallerinde gerilimi \u00f6l\u00e7\u00fcn<\/a> sistem \u0131s\u0131 talebinde bulunurken.<\/li>\n<li>30 amperlik sigortalar\u0131n sa\u011flam ve do\u011fru \u015fekilde yerle\u015ftirilmi\u015f oldu\u011funu kontrol edin.<\/li>\n<li>T\u00fcm kablo ba\u011flant\u0131lar\u0131n\u0131 korozyon veya gev\u015fek temas a\u00e7\u0131s\u0131ndan inceleyin.<\/li>\n<li>Kontrol kart\u0131ndaki \u0131s\u0131t\u0131c\u0131 r\u00f6lesini test edin.<\/li>\n<li>Is\u0131t\u0131c\u0131 eleman\u0131n direncini bir multimetre ile do\u011frulay\u0131n; iyi bir eleman 9\u201312 ohm aras\u0131nda okumal\u0131d\u0131r.<\/li>\n<li>Y\u00fcksek limit termostat\u0131 ve bas\u0131n\u00e7 anahtar\u0131 gibi g\u00fcvenlik kontrollerini inceleyin; bu par\u00e7alar ar\u0131zal\u0131ysa \u0131s\u0131tmay\u0131 engelleyebilir.<\/li>\n<li>Do\u011fru su ak\u0131\u015f\u0131n\u0131 sa\u011flay\u0131n ve do\u011fru su seviyesini koruyun.<\/li>\n<li>Sens\u00f6r ar\u0131zalar\u0131n\u0131 \u00f6nlemek i\u00e7in filtreleri temizleyin ve dengeli su kimyas\u0131n\u0131 koruyun.<\/li>\n\n<\/ol>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p>Bu ad\u0131mlar\u0131 tamamlad\u0131ktan sonra \u0131s\u0131t\u0131c\u0131 h\u00e2l\u00e2 g\u00fc\u00e7 alm\u0131yorsa, ar\u0131zal\u0131 bir bile\u015fen veya kontrol kart\u0131 sorunu a\u00e7\u0131s\u0131ndan daha fazla inceleme yapman\u0131z gerekebilir.<\/p>\n<\/blockquote>\n\n\n\n<h4 class=\"wp-block-heading\" >De\u011fi\u015fim Sonras\u0131 Hata Kodlar\u0131 veya Is\u0131 Yok<\/h4>\n\n\n\n<p class=\"wp-block-paragraph\">Bazen ba\u015far\u0131l\u0131 bir kurulumdan sonra bile hata kodlar\u0131 g\u00f6rebilir veya \u0131s\u0131 olmad\u0131\u011f\u0131n\u0131 fark edebilirsiniz.
